Why Event Preview Blogs Matter
Events should always be promoted in calendars but previewing the event enables you to go further and share the background that engages.
If you're organizing a community event, it helps you to get credit for your efforts... "no, that other group didn't plan this event :("
- Increase event visibility by reaching new audiences early.
- Boost attendance by showcasing what makes your event special.
- Recognize key participants (vendors, sponsors, volunteers) to strengthen partnerships.
- Improve SEO with event-related keywords that drive traffic to your website.
- Create anticipation with behind-the-scenes content and exclusive previews.
A Prompt-Based Approach to Event Preview Blogs
1. Announce the Event Clearly
Include the event's basics and link to the event in your calendar
Highlight the purpose of the event and why people should attend.
2. Tell the Story Behind the Event
Share the event’s history or what inspired it.
Feature past successes or memorable moments from previous years.
Highlight the impact the event has on the community or industry.
3. Spotlight Key Participants
Recognize vendors, sponsors, speakers, and volunteers.
Include quotes or testimonials from participants.
Showcase unique experiences, attractions, or exclusive offerings.
4. Build Excitement with Behind-the-Scenes Content
Share sneak peeks of event setup, special features, or limited-time offers.
Post interviews with organizers or past attendees.
Tease surprises or unique experiences attendees can look forward to.
5. Encourage Engagement & Sharing
Create an event hashtag for social media promotion.
Ask partners, vendors, and attendees to share the article.
Offer incentives like early-bird specials or giveaways for engagement.
Small Steps, Big Wins for Event Preview Success
Even small efforts in your event preview can lead to big results. Here are some quick wins:
Repurpose content across multiple channels—email, social media, blog posts.
Get vendors and sponsors involved in promoting the event.
Use countdowns and teaser posts to build anticipation.
Make it easy for people to share—provide sample captions or event hashtags.
